Detailed Description
Dive into the extended narrative that explains the scientific background, objectives, and procedures in greater depth.
The primary objective of the trial is to determine the impact of two different levels of support service, group A1 and A2, provided by MSLL within Group A, on adherence to prescribed treatment in newly diagnosed or first-switch relapsing remitting multiple sclerosis (RRMS) subjects.
Secondary Objective:
The secondary objectives are:
* To use a pair wise comparison to determine the impact on adherence of the two different levels of service intervention provided by MSLL not compared in the primary objective (Standard services subgroup of Group A (A1) to Group B and Customized service subgroup of Group A (A2) to Group B)
* To determine the correlation of adherence with subject-reported outcomes and other study data;
* To examine the changes from baseline in subject-reported outcomes in each service arm;
* To examine changes from baseline in risk for non-adherence in each service arm; and
* To determine rate of trial dropout between each service arm

Study Groups
Review each arm or cohort in the study, along with the interventions and objectives associated with them.
Standard Services of Group A (Group A1)
Standard Services of Group A (Group A1)
Support services provided in this group will include: Initial field nurse injection training visit; field nurse follow-up and subsequent visits; and follow-up phone calls at periodic intervals
Customized Services of Group A (Group A2)
Customized Services of Group A (Group A2)
In addition to the initial field nurse injection training visit and follow-up call, subjects will select from support services including field nurse follow-up visits; follow-up phone calls; email and/or text reminders; subject self-assessment and use of treatment planning tools; and mail/e-mail educational materials.
Group B
Group B
Support services provided in this group will include initial field nurse injection training visit and follow-up phone calls at periodic intervals.

Eligibility Criteria
Check the participation requirements, including inclusion and exclusion rules, age limits, and whether healthy volunteers are accepted.
Inclusion Criteria
* Male or female
* Female subjects of child bearing potential who report they are not pregnant at screening and agree to avoid pregnancy during study participation by using adequate contraception, defined as two barrier methods, one barrier method with a spermicide, intrauterine device, or use of oral female contraceptive
* Outpatient status at time of online screening
* Subjects prescribed Rebif by their treating physicians as the first disease-modifying drug (DMD) they have received, or up to one prior treatment with either Rebif, Copaxone ®, Avonex ® , Extavia ®, Betaseron ®, Gilenya™, and Aubagio ® (with accelerated elimination), Tysabri ® and Tecfidera™
* Access to, and ability to use, a computer, a mouse, the internet, and an email address. In addition, subjects in the Group A will be required to have access to a telephone that accepts text messaging (in case randomized to the Custom subgroup)
* Subject-reported ability to complete online assignments and read English
* Electronically verified informed consent before any trial-related activities are carried out
Exclusion Criteria
* Score of 4 on any of the items of the MSRS-R or a score between 5 and 8, inclusive, on the PDDS
* Surgical intervention planned during the 12-month study period
* Pregnant or breastfeeding. Note subjects who are 90 days postpartum, stable, and do not breastfeed may participate.
* History of malignancy, with the exception of skin cancer completely excised and considered cured;
* History of seizures or unexplained blackouts within 30 days prior to online screening
* Current illegal drug use at the time of online screening;
* Any prior participation in an interventional clinical trial for MS (except for Aubagio ® or Tecfidera™), participation in any trial within 30 days prior to online screening, or current participation in another clinical trial;
* Current treatment of another autoimmune disorder other than stable thyroid disease at the time of online screening
* History of prior treatment for MS with any of the following: alemtuzumab, cyclophosphamide, methotrexate, azathioprine, cyclosporin, intravenous immunoglobulin (IVIg), and plasma exchange
* Other significant subject-reported disease that would exclude the subject from the trial
* Significant renal or hepatic impairment that would compromise completion of the trial
